Output 660b421ed10e04614fe95c7c138f7f69f79896d70808ebe1706c4cb3e599797a:1

value
752584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30da31aef1b1460dbbb42005ae77cd7c7ccdda5e OP_EQUAL
address
369Kk9BB62irJbqzbUpL8YXDA7rubuxx8c
transaction
660b421ed10e04614fe95c7c138f7f69f79896d70808ebe1706c4cb3e599797a
spent
true